Factors Influencing Coffee Prices
Understanding the coffee market needs an expedition of several crucial factors that affect prices.
1. Supply and Demand
The balance between coffee supply and demand is perhaps the most considerable factor affecting prices. When demand spikes-- such as throughout seasonal durations or within emerging markets-- prices tend to increase. On the other hand, surplus coffee harvests can lead to lower prices.
2. Coffee Bean Type
The kind of coffee bean plays an essential role in prices. Arabica beans typically command greater prices due to their remarkable flavor and quality. Robusta beans are less costly, as they are much easier to cultivate and have higher yields.
3. Growing Conditions
Coffee beans need specific environment conditions and elevation to grow. Issues such as climate change, natural catastrophes, and illness like coffee leaf rust can badly interfere with materials and affect prices. Regions experiencing adverse climate condition may see a spike in prices due to lower yields.
4. Processing Methods
The approach used for processing coffee beans-- such as wet or dry processing-- can impact both the taste and the price. Specialty coffee that is carefully processed often comes at a premium.
5. Export Fees and Trade Policies
Depending on trade arrangements, export costs, and tariffs, the expense of importing coffee can change. Countries that offer fair trade practices often have greater prices, but they guarantee more fair compensation for farmers.

Q: Why is Arabica coffee more costly than Robusta?A: Arabica usually has a more complicated taste profile, needs more rigorous growing conditions, and has lower yields compared to Robusta.
Q: Are there benefits to buying specialized coffee?A: Yes, specialty coffee is typically fresher and of greater quality. It also frequently supports sustainable and ethical farming practices.

Q: How can I save coffee beans to preserve their freshness?A: Store coffee beans in an airtight container in a cool, dark place. Avoid direct exposure to moisture, heat, and light, as these can degrade the flavor.
